How Poor Sleep Ages the Body
- Skin health: During deep sleep, collagen is rebuilt. Without it, skin loses elasticity, fine lines deepen, and the famous “tired look” sets in.
- Stress hormones: Interrupted sleep raises cortisol, which breaks down collagen and slows cell repair.
- Tension build‑up: Neck and shoulder tightness from poor support creates chronic fatigue, making the body feel years older.
The Cycle of Micro‑Awakenings
Even if you don’t realise it, tossing and turning creates dozens of “micro‑awakenings.” Each one pulls you out of the deep restorative phases where true repair happens. Over time, your body spends more nights in survival mode and fewer in renewal.
